  • First video back for 2022 - I spray some PGR on my Kikuyu to try and slow it down after the La-Nina summer we're having. Give it a fresh cut, and check out some creeping (sprinting) Oxalis.

      @@theoutbacklawnie1433 I like the mower. I need 2 batteries to do my lawn properly though. If I double- cut front, back and side lawns it takes a bit of juice. The other major issue is that it's much lighter than a petrol engined mower, so it slips and slides around on top of the grass some times.
